SQL*Plus - командная строка для работы с базами данных в Oracle. Создание нового пользователя позволяет предоставить доступ к базе данных, устанавливая привилегии и ограничения.
Для создания нового пользователя в SQL*Plus необходимо войти как администратор. После успешной аутентификации выполните команду CREATE USER, указав имя пользователя, пароль, привилегии и ограничения.
Например, чтобы создать пользователя с именем "john" и паролем "password", можно выполнить следующую команду:
Шаги по созданию пользователя в sqlplus
База данных Oracle предоставляет удобный инструмент sqlplus для работы с базами данных. Для создания пользователя в sqlplus необходимо выполнить следующие шаги:
Шаг 1:
Откройте командную строку или терминал и введите команду sqlplus, чтобы запустить инструмент:
sqlplus
Шаг 2:
Войдите в систему под учетной записью администратора базы данных с помощью команды:
CONNECT sys AS sysdba;
Шаг 3:
Создайте нового пользователя с помощью команды CREATE USER:
CREATE USER username IDENTIFIED BY password;
Замените "username" на имя пользователя, которое вы хотите создать, и "password" на пароль для этого пользователя.
Шаг 4:
Назначьте нужные привилегии пользователю с помощью команды GRANT:
GRANT privilege TO username;
Замените "privilege" на необходимые привилегии, такие как SELECT, INSERT, UPDATE, DELETE и так далее.
Шаг 5:
Для сохранения изменений выполните команду COMMIT:
COMMIT;
Теперь вы успешно создали нового пользователя в sqlplus и можете использовать его для работы с базой данных Oracle.
Установка и настройка sqlplus
Шаг 1: Установка Oracle Instant Client
Для работы с sqlplus требуется установить Oracle Instant Client. Вы можете загрузить его с официального сайта Oracle и следовать инструкциям по установке.
Шаг 2: Настройка переменных среды
После установки Oracle Instant Client необходимо настроить переменные среды, чтобы ваш компьютер мог найти файлы sqlplus. Добавьте путь к директории, где установлен Oracle Instant Client, в переменную среды PATH.
Шаг 3: Проверка установки
Откройте командную строку и введите команду sqlplus. Если установка прошла успешно, вы увидите приглашение для ввода логина и пароля.
Шаг 4: Настройка подключения
Для подключения к базе данных в sqlplus, необходимо указать информацию о сервере, имя пользователя и пароль. Вы можете использовать команду connect:
Команда | Описание |
---|---|
connect username/password@server | Подключение к базе данных с указанным именем пользователя, паролем и сервером |
Замените "username" на ваше имя пользователя, "password" на ваш пароль и "server" на адрес сервера базы данных.
Теперь вы можете начать использовать sqlplus для управления базами данных Oracle. Удачной работы!
Создание нового пользователя в sqlplus
В Oracle SQLPlus можно создавать новых пользователей с помощью команды CREATE USER
. Для этого нужно иметь соответствующие привилегии, а также правильно указать необходимые параметры.
Пример команды создания нового пользователя:
CREATE USER username
IDENTIFIED BY password;
Вместо username
нужно указать желаемое имя нового пользователя, а вместо password
- его пароль. Пароль должен соответствовать требованиям безопасности и быть достаточно сложным.
После выполнения команды, будет создан новый пользователь. Ему будет присвоено имя схемы, совпадающее с его именем пользователя.
Если нужно дать новому пользователю дополнительные привилегии, можно добавить соответствующие параметры в команду CREATE USER
. Например:
CREATE USER имя_пользователя
IDENTIFIED BY пароль
DEFAULT TABLESPACE users
TEMPORARY TABLESPACE temp
QUOTA 100M ON users;
В приведенном примере новому пользователю будет назначено таблица по умолчанию users
, временное пространство temp
и квота 100 МБ в таблице users
.
Создание нового пользователя в Oracle SQLPlus является достаточно простым, но требует правильного указания необходимых параметров.
Установка прав доступа для нового пользователя в sqlplus
После создания нового пользователя в SQLPlus важно установить ему права доступа, чтобы он мог выполнять нужные операции в базе данных. Для этого следует использовать команду GRANT.
Ниже приведен общий формат команды GRANT:
GRANT ON TO ;
Здесь:
- уровень_доступа - уровень доступа, который требуется предоставить. Например, SELECT, INSERT, UPDATE или DELETE.
- имя_таблицы - имя таблицы, на которую необходимо предоставить доступ.
- имя_пользователя - имя пользователя, которому нужно предоставить доступ.
Пример команды GRANT для предоставления пользователю доступа к таблице employees:
GRANT SELECT ON employees TO new_user;
Эта команда предоставляет доступ к чтению данных из таблицы employees для пользователя new_user.
Дополнительно можно предоставить доступ к нескольким таблицам, указав их имена через запятую:
GRANT SELECT, INSERT, UPDATE ON table1, table2 TO new_user;
После выполнения команды GRANT новый пользователь сможет выполнять указанные операции на заданных таблицах.
Важно установить только необходимые права доступа для нового пользователя, чтобы минимизировать риски безопасности и защитить данные в базе данных.